Travin Howard out for season

9/1/2020

0 Comments

 
Los Angeles Rams linebacker Travin Howard will miss the 2020 season due to a meniscus injury that will require surgery.

Sean McVay says that LB Travin Howard tore his meniscus, will have surgery and is out for the season.

— Jourdan Rodrigue (@JourdanRodrigue) September 1, 2020

Howard spent his rookie year on the practice squad last season, and his spot was purely a depth position. However, now the Rams have even more problems with depth at the linebacker position.
